Key Market Indicators

New Zealand's polypropylene import is expected to dip to 10.1 million kilograms by 2026, from 11.9 million kilograms in 2021 - a 3.1% drop year-on-year, on average. Since 1994, New Zealand's demand has decreased 4.1% year-on-year. In 2021, the country came in 78th place, with Zimbabwe ahead of it at 11.9 million kilograms. Italy, Germany and Indonesia were 2nd, 3rd and 4th respectively in this ranking. New Zealand's polypropylene export, meanwhile, is projected to fall 11% year-on-year to 45,350 kilograms by 2026, from 86,430 kilograms in 2021. Since 1994, New Zealand's supply had increased by 25.5% year-on-year. In 2021, the country was 90th in the rankings, with Nicaragua overtaking it at 86,430 kilograms. South Korea, Germany and Singapore placed 2nd, 3rd and 4th respectively.
